Sizing Information

I measured a selection of these pants and found the waist size of the pants to measure out consistently at 2” larger than the stated size. Most men’s jeans will be sized this way these days…. it’s called vanity sizing. We recommend you measure your waist or the waistband of your favorite jeans to see what size pants you need. The waist sizes for each pant size can be adjusted down by 2 to 3 inches with the side waist adjusters.

Inseam on the regular size pants is about 33” and inseam on the tall size pants is about 35”.

Here is a chart I put together to show you how each pant size measures out so you can select the size based upon what you come up with when you measure yourself.

Pant Size Max Waist Size Inseam Regular Inseam Tall Inseam Short
30 32 33 - -
32 34 33 35 31
34 36 33 35 31
36 38 33 35 31
38 40 33 35 31
40 42 33 - 31
42 44 33 - -

Our Two Cents

The Baja S4 Pants from Klim are new for Spring 2025 and are now in their second generation. Like the rest of the Baja S4 line, the pants are designed for hot weather, adventure riding. Overall construction is a combination of schoeller-dynatech high tenacity nylon mesh, karbonite 4 way stretch 1000D cordura, 750D cordura, and super fabric. This combination of materials earns a CE AA rating.

Sizing is handled numerically, with sizes ranging from 30 to 44 for the regular version, 30 to 40 in the short and 32 to 38 in the tall. For me at six foot, roughly 215 pounds I tried on a pair of regular length pants in a 36 waist, what I normally wear in my everyday jeans and I found a good fit. WIth that said since I am much more torso than I am legs, I found a better fit with the short version of the pants so happy to see Klim offering different lengths. 

The main closure is a simple zipper closure with two buttons on top, which stay nice and secure, and the zipper is covered with an oversized flap. There are cargo pockets on each side of the front, they are a good size and they feature a zipper closure, keep in mind however that there are no regular “jean like” pockets in the front, only the cargos. Also on the front Klim included some reflective materials, I love seeing that, especially because their size and shape makes them visible from the front, back and sides. The knees have super fabric on them and on the inside of the legs there is goat leather which is great to help grip the tank, while resisting scratches and wear and tear. 

Additional included features are a long connection zipper that matches up to the Baja S4 jacket, adjusters at the hip to get the perfect fit, as well as additional fit adjusters at the calf. At the very bottom of the pants there is a bit more reflective material, as well as zippers and tab adjusters to help with both getting in and out of the pants as well as getting the fit just right. 

Included armor is D30 CE Level 1 at both the knees and hips, and the knee armor is height adjustable. Overall the Baja S4 pants are designed with both temperature and movement comfort in mind and with a DWR treatment they will shed water as well but if you’re looking for waterproofness you’ll want to add the Enduro S4 outer layer to this.
